Transaction 59ff126de123ce95c50dc4136c38f429587df44aeb5bc63bcb4a777bfebd3369

1 Input
2 Outputs
  • 59ff126de123ce95c50dc4136c38f429587df44aeb5bc63bcb4a777bfebd3369:0
  • value  56868
    address  18aHUQZYNxfywFdUeTAXgSwKy6JoEurvTs
  • 59ff126de123ce95c50dc4136c38f429587df44aeb5bc63bcb4a777bfebd3369:1
  • value  7208155
    address  32roPxr3ttojyhMLEvWjRGZ5RKEmVr9oiK